Overview

Gus Davis is a French bulldog who thinks he can do anything—even swim. Bean is Gus’s human best friend who thinks bulldogs aren’t designed for the water.

Who is right?

It turns out, they both are!

All it takes is a persistent bulldog and a creative human friend to prove that, with a little practice and adaptation, anything is possible. The Unsinkable Gus Davis is a playful story about figuring things out, staying safe around water, and laughing along the way!

About the Author

Laurie Trumble Davis is a book lover who lives in Hopkinton, Massachusetts, with her family. They spend their summers on Cape Cod at Schoolhouse Pond, where Gus, her French bulldog, believed he was the best swimmer on the pond. And he was. . . especially when wearing his life jacket! A lifelong lover of books, fun, and adventure, she is passionate about stories that help children develop strength, courage, and self-confidence.

Paulette Bogan is the author and illustrator of many beloved books for children, including Virgil & Owen, Virgil & Owen Stick Together, and Bossy Flossy. She lives in New York City with her family. They spend their summers at the Jersey Shore, where Moof, her Havanese, is afraid of the water and doesn’t like sand on his paws.
